Thu, Jan 28: Minister of Environment and Climate Change is a title that never would have existed under Canada’s previous Conservative government, but the Liberals are making the environment, and our impact on it, a priority and Catherine McKenna is the woman in charge of it. Mike Le Couteur reports.
